Report on the use of Firewalls in Network Security

Introduction:
A firewall is defined as a piece of software or hardware used to enforce network security policies by monitoring both internal and external network traffic ensuring that unwanted access or data is prohibited. Most of the modern firewalls that are used today are software based solutions however some exist as hardware solution with embedded software logic. Many authors on firewall technologies are of the opinion that the firewall acts as a bridge between a private internal network and external networks such as the internet. The primary functions of a firewall are as follows: * It limits the entry points to a network * Prevents malicious software or individuals from entering the private network * It limits the exit points from the network
Since all traffic leaving and entering the internal network the firewall is considered to be the single most important tool to be used to protect a network. It allows the network administrators to know exactly the state of the network security.
Currently, there are different types of firewall implementation. These ranges from dedicated routers and switches with embedded software to a single dedicated host computer with appropriate software. A firewall does not exist as a single piece of hardware solution. In fact, it is the software that is hosted by the hardware that is capable of carrying out the appropriate analyses of the network traffic to ensure that the correct policies are enforced. To achieve this, a firewall normally utilizes one or more of the following technologies: 1. Packet – Filtering 2. Proxy

Types of firewalls

Generally, a firewall is categorized by the type of technology that it uses. The two main types of firewalls are: Packet – Filtering Firewalls and Proxy Firewalls.

In the context of corporate financial reporting, the income statement summarizes a company's revenues and expenses quarterly and annually for its fiscal year. The final net figures, as well as various others in this statement, are of major interest to the investment community. Investors must remind themselves that the income statement recognizes revenues when they are realized. With accrual accounting, the flow of accounting events through the income statement doesn't necessarily coincide with the actual receipt and disbursement of cash. It is essential to get relevant license from the Microsoft in order to use this technology because it is a proprietary technology. * Silverlight Silverlight is a powerful development tool for creating engaging, interactive user experiences for Web and mobile applications. Silverlight is a free plug-in, powered by the .NET framework and compatible with multiple browsers, devices and operating systems, bringing a new level of interactivity wherever the Web works. In Silverlight applications, user interfaces are declared in Extensible Application Markup Language (XAML) and programmed using a subset of the .NET Framework. Advantages of Silverlight include, * Rich UI applications using WPF * Cross-browser, cross-platform plug-in * Rich Media experience. Possible to collaborate Media objects such as Video Streaming, Animations, etc. * Search-engine friendly Silverlight applications can be written in any .NET programming language.
